Output 3dd9dfc0bb6ee213101d98ef3a965f7ec3c98aca3a3475fccc3b2c331f044874:1

value
3107431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b7d00fd36e1262f06b130bfa67885ce5b664e6 OP_EQUAL
address
3Mp4nHAuk9ZNyvnbc41tM7v9V8xzv8ot5T
transaction
3dd9dfc0bb6ee213101d98ef3a965f7ec3c98aca3a3475fccc3b2c331f044874
confirmations
299685
spent
true